Beta Testing
Acceptance testing performed by the customer in a live application of the software, at one or more end user sites, in an environment not controlled by the developer.
Beta Testing
For medical device software such use may require an Investigational Device Exemption (IDE) or Institutional Review Board (IRB) approval.
Beta-lactam Antibiotics
Penicillins, cephalosporins, monobactams, and carbapenems. Other APIs containing beta-lactam rings; beta-lactamase inhibitors,clavulanic acid, and sulbactam and tazobactam; typically with sensitization potential.
